XPeng Announces Vehicle Delivery Results for February 2021

Chinese smart EV maker XPeng Inc. today announced its vehicle delivery results for February 2021.

XPeng delivered a total of 2,223 Smart EVs in February 2021, consisting of 1,409 P7s, the Company’s smart sports sedan, and 814 G3s, its smart compact SUV.

Vehicle deliveries in January and February 2021 combined represented a 577% increase year-over-year. Cumulative P7 deliveries reached 20,181 since its launch in the second quarter 2020.

February deliveries reflect the anticipated seasonal decline in deliveries due to the slowdown in the week-long Chinese New Year holiday. The Company is witnessing robust customer demand as sales and delivery activities resumed after the holiday.

The record-breaking delivery results reflect the strong market appeal of XPeng’s products and services as the Company accelerates its delivery capabilities and launch of new smart features, expanding brand awareness and marketing efforts.

The new version of P7’s operating system, Xmart OS 2.5.0 was released to customers on January 26th this year, optimizing 200+ features and adding 40+ new functions including the navigation assisted highway autonomous driving solution NGP (Navigation Guided Pilot).
